Nursery
During Sunday services, we offer God-centered childcare for children from birth through age 4. Our professional staff is committed to providing a warm, nurturing environment with Bible stories, music and fellowship.
We offer childcare during worship on Sundays from 8:45 am to 12:30 pm and 4:45 pm to 6:15 pm. Childcare is also available during church-wide events.
For safety, we ask that parents use our check-in procedure. Parents are welcome to stay with their children in the nursery until both parent and child are comfortable with the
nursery setting.

Nursey Procedures
In order to maintain a secure environment for your child, we ask that parents follow proper procedures when checking their child(ren) into the Nursery. Parents/guardians should fill out a Child Care Information Card so that we have the information we need to best assist your child while in our care.
- Sign each child in at the check-in table located outside the nursery door.
- Select a pair of numbered badges from the basket. Keep one badge with you for pick up and clip the matching badge to your child.
- Include name, age, badge #, cell phone # and any allergies. While in church, please keep your cell phone on vibrate in case of emergency.
- For infants, use the stickers provided. One sticker goes on the child and the other remains with the parent for pick up.
- Red Badges are available for any children with allergies; it will alert the providers to check the sign-in sheet for further instruction.
- Children from birth to age two will be in Noah’s Nursery, and children ages three or four will be placed in Daniel’s Lions.
- At pick-up, sign your child out at the table and return your badge.
